tropcy_qc_reloc.v5.1.1 ----- (last modified August 10, 2015) tropcy_qc_reloc.v5.1.1 directory currently includes hurricane related scripts/code for GFS/GDAS. There are three main functionalities in the scripts/code: 1) global TC vital data collection and data quality control 2) tropical storm relocation 3) TC tracker for application in GFS relocation and GFS post jobs The scripts/code are upgrades from the tropcy_qc_reloc 5.0.1, and have the flexibility to do hourly relocation and 3-hourly relocation. The tropcy_qc_reloc 5.1.1 includes the following changes: 1) remove the TC vitals marked as (WV, ET or LO) from storm relocation (and storm bogus data creation) 2) combine hourly relocation with 3-hourly relocation. 3) unify the build.sh (named as ubuild.sh) for different machines (WCOSS, Zeus and others). 1. Code Changes: 1) relocation code is upgraded to handle both hourly relocation and 3-hourly relocation 2) tracker code is upgraded to output hourly storm positions for hurricane relocation. This is accomplished in subroutine output_all and utilizes a namelist variable called atcffreq to determine if output is hourly or 3-hourly. 2. USH script changes: The following scripts are changed: tropcy_relocate.sh tropcy_relocate_extrkr.sh syndat_qctropcy.sh getges.sh global_extrkr.sh -- Most of the changes to this script were to ensure compliance with new variable name standards for phase-2 compatibility. However, one substantial change that was made was to include scripting code to create the appropriate storm ID directory under ATCFdir if the directory does not already exist. 5. Fix file changes: gdas.tracker_leadtimes_hrly <== new syndat_stmnames <== no change syndat_fildef.vit <== no change gfs_hgt_levs.txt <== no change gfs_tmp_levs.txt <== no change syndat_slmask.t126.gaussian <== no changes gdas.tracker_leadtimes <== no change NOTE: For the JGFS_CYCLONE_TRACKER job in the GFS post-processing, the "tracker_leadtimes" file is not pulled from a fix file / fix directory. Instead, that tracker_leadtimes file is created on the fly from within the global_extrkr.sh script. 6.
